在一个繁忙的都市角落,一位司机焦急地寻找加油站,却因不熟悉路况而迷失方向。此刻,他手中的加油卡却成了他的救命稻草,通过手机上的加油卡系统,他迅速找到了最近的加油站,并享受了便捷的加油服务。
加油卡系统,作为现代智能交通管理系统的重要组成部分,不仅极大地提升了加油服务的便捷性,还为用户提供了更加智能、个性化的出行体验。那么,如何搭建这样一个高效、稳定的加油卡系统呢?
在搭建加油卡系统之初,首先要进行充分的市场调研和需求分析。通过深入了解用户的使用习惯、支付偏好和出行需求,我们可以确定系统的核心功能和扩展性要求。例如,系统需要支持多种支付方式,包括银行卡、移动支付等;同时,还需要具备实时更新油价、加油站位置信息的功能,以满足用户随时随地的查询需求。
在明确需求的基础上,我们需要制定详细的功能清单和技术规格书。这些文档将作为后续开发工作的基础,确保系统能够满足用户的实际需求。
系统设计是加油卡系统搭建的关键环节。在这个阶段,我们需要根据需求分析的结果,设计系统的整体架构和模块划分。一般来说,加油卡系统可以分为用户端、管理端和后台数据库三个主要部分。
用户端主要负责与用户进行交互,提供查询、支付、积分兑换等功能;管理端则用于管理员对系统进行维护和管理,包括用户信息管理、加油站信息管理、数据统计等;后台数据库则用于存储系统的核心数据,包括用户信息、加油站信息、交易记录等。
在设计系统架构时,我们需要考虑系统的可扩展性、稳定性和安全性。例如,可以采用微服务架构来降低系统的耦合度,提高系统的可扩展性;同时,还需要采用加密算法和防火墙技术来确保系统的数据安全。
在系统设计完成后,我们进入到了系统开发的阶段。在这个阶段,开发人员需要根据设计文档进行编码实现,并不断完善和优化系统的功能。在开发过程中,我们需要采用合适的开发工具和框架来提高开发效率和质量。
同时,我们还需要进行系统的测试验证工作。测试工作可以分为单元测试、集成测试和系统测试三个阶段。通过严格的测试验证,我们可以确保系统的稳定性和可靠性,减少系统上线后出现问题的风险。
在系统开发完成后,我们需要将系统部署到实际环境中进行运行。在部署过程中,我们需要考虑系统的硬件和软件环境要求,以及系统的备份和恢复策略。同时,我们还需要制定详细的系统维护计划,以确保系统能够长期稳定运行。
在系统上线运行后,我们还需要不断收集用户反馈和数据统计信息,对系统进行持续优化和改进。例如,可以根据用户的使用习惯和支付偏好来调整系统的功能和界面设计;同时,还可以利用大数据分析技术来挖掘用户的潜在需求和行为模式,为系统的发展提供有力的支持。
在加油卡系统的搭建过程中,安全保障是至关重要。我们需要从多个方面入手,确保系统的数据安全和用户隐私得到保护。 我们需要采用现代化的加密技术和防火墙技术来防止数据泄露和黑客攻击; 我们还需要建立完善的用户认证和授权机制,确保只有合法用户才能访问系统; 我们还需要制定严格的数据备份和恢复策略,以防止因意外事件导致的数据丢失或损坏。
回望整个加油卡系统的搭建过程,我们仿佛看到了一座智慧桥梁在缓缓搭建。这座桥梁连接着用户与加油站,让出行变得更加便捷、高效;同时,也连接着技术与安全,让数据在传输和存储过程中得到了充分的保护。在未来的日子里,让我们继续携手前行,用科技的力量为人们的出行生活带来更多便捷与惊喜!